Phow服务器软件集成套件的安装问题和解决方法_PHP技巧_黑客防线网安服务器维护基地--Powered by WWW.RONGSEN.COM.CN

Phow服务器软件集成套件的安装问题和解决方法

作者:黑客防线网安PHP教程基地 来源:黑客防线网安PHP教程基地 浏览次数:0

本篇关键词:问题解决方法安装
黑客防线网安网讯:  Phpnow是个傻瓜式的服务器软件集成套件,Win32下绿色免费的Apache+PHP+MySQL环境套件包,网址是http://phpnow.org/,其网站上提供了下载链接,有需要的朋友可以去看一看。这个套件让你方...
  Phpnow是个傻瓜式的服务器软件集成套件Win32下绿色免费的Apache+PHP+MySQL环境套件包网址是http://phpnow.org/,其网站上提供了下载链接,有需要的朋友可以去看一看这个套件让你方便地在Win32平台下建立服务器环境,好处是便利,坏处不说也罢,下面讲讲我在使用时遇到的问题和解决方法(Phpnow的安装方法请参见http://phpnow.org/guide.html
  
  注:我目前在使用的版本是PHPnow-1.4.5-20
  
  1、phpnow添加虚拟主机。
  
  上图出自phpnow.org,简单说明了虚拟主机的开设方法,关键是对于本机,得懂得修改host文件:
  
  如果没有域名或者不会用,可以通过编辑C:WINDOWSsystem32driversetchosts来使用“虚拟域名”。
  
  本例中的bbs.test.com就是在“127.0.0.1localhost”的下一行添加一行“127.0.0.1bbs.test.com”实现的。
  
  对于本机,我推荐这样设置:
  
  运行PnCp.cmd,把主机名和主机别名都设置为localhost2,目录就是你想设置到的硬盘上任何一个目录,如D:localhost2,最后一步中把“限制虚拟主机权限”设为n,然后在host文件中添加进一行“127.0.0.1localhost2”。这时,打开浏览器,输入http://localhost2/即可得到正确的页面。查看D:localhost2文件夹,会发现多了一个index.php,这是phpnow添加进去的,可删除。(说得很基础吧--)如果在安装Phpnow时用了别的端口,如我用了8080,就可以用网址http://localhost2:8080/进行访问。
  
  2.为Apache配置SSI
  
  在Phpnow中找到Apache文件夹,进入Apacheconf,找到httpd.conf文件,用Dreamweaver打开,不推荐用记事本打开,因为会乱码而出错,最好先备份一个。
  
  打开后,找到这一行:#AddTypetext/html.shtml,会看到紧接着的是#AddOutputFilterINCLUDES.shtml,把前面的#号去掉,这样可以让Apache通过SSI方式加入.shtml后缀的文件了,为了让html和htm的文件也行,添加这几句:
  
  AddTypetext/html.html
  
  AddOutputFilterINCLUDES.html
  
  AddTypetext/html.htm
  
  AddOutputFilterINCLUDES.htm
  
  保存文件。这样OK了吗?未,这样还不够的,再进入文件夹extra,即Apacheconfextra,找到httpd-vhosts.conf,同样用Dreamweaver打开,你会看到文件中有这几行:
  
  <Directory“D:/localhost2″>
  
  Allowfromall
  
  </Directory>
  
  修改成这样:
  
  <Directory“D:/localhost2″>
  
  OptionsIncludesIndexesFollowSymLinks
  
  Allowfromall
  
  </Directory>
  
  这里的OptionsIncludesIndexesFollowSymLinks是一个对当前目录的设置选项,Options后面跟的分别是
  
  Includes——允许服务器引入,Indexes——允许目录索引(针对无index.html时列出文件),FollowSymLinks——不会解释介个了^_^
  
  一切就序,重启Apache吧:还是运行PnCp.cmd,看对应的操作输入23重启Apache,命令窗口闪一下就没了,一切安好,这样,可以SSI的服务环境就配置成功了。
  
  3.一些小细节
  
  上面看到,我把Indexes也添加进去了,因为在本地机中,如果没有索引文件的情况下,可查看目录文件还是有利于工作的:)但要完善这个小细节,还得再做些修改。返回Apacheconf,打开httpd.conf(不要用记事本打开哦:)),找到这行:
  
  #LoadModuleautoindex_modulemodules/mod_autoindex.so
  
  把前面的#号去掉,这样就可以列目录了。再找到这行:
  
  <IfModulemod_autoindex.c>
  
  而套中其中的,可以找到这一行:
  
  IndexOptionsFancyIndexingVersionSort
  
  这一行才是我们要修改的东西,把这行改为:
  
  IndexOptionsFancyIndexingVersionSortNameWidth=*
  
  这就是为了让长文件名也可以显示出来。保存,再重启Apache,完美了
  
  本文写得很口水,主要目的是笔记,其次也是分享(不是分享为先的么--)
  
  
    黑客防线网安服务器维护方案本篇连接:http://www.rongsen.com.cn/show-17509-1.html
网站维护教程更新时间:2012-09-21 05:20:20  【打印此页】  【关闭
我要申请本站N点 | 黑客防线官网 |  
专业服务器维护及网站维护手工安全搭建环境,网站安全加固服务。黑客防线网安服务器维护基地招商进行中!QQ:29769479

footer  footer  footer  footer